支持业务运营

Description of your first forum.
Post Reply
asimd23
Posts: 592
Joined: Mon Dec 23, 2024 3:25 am

支持业务运营

Post by asimd23 »

在微服务架构中构建 数据库时,主表和子表之间的实体关系可能会受到几种影响。每个微服务通常管理自己的数据,这可能导致数据管理分散。这意味着主表和子表之间的关系可能需要跨多个微服务进行管理,这可能比传统的单片架构更复杂。

这也可以通过跨多个微服务的重复表来 伊朗手机号码数据 管理,或者企业可以在应用程序层中管理实体关系,这意味着可以在数据库中独立读取写入数据。在这种情况下,应用程序代码将在读取或写入数据后处理实体关系。

话虽如此,对于任何依赖数据的企业来说,正确规划数据库都至关重要。考虑实施与 相关的以下最佳实践:

有效地组织和管理数据。 合理规划的数据库可以以合乎逻辑且有效的方式构建数据,从而更轻松地存储、检索和更新信息。
确保数据的准确性和一致性。 规划数据库结构和数据类型可以确保数据的准确性和一致性,减少错误和不一致。

精心规划的数据库可以提供必要的数据来支持销售、库存、客户管理和财务报告等业务运营。

使用合适的硬件。 数据库需要快速的处理速度和低延迟的数据访问。固态硬盘 和高性能处理器等硬件可以确保数据库的高效运行。
优化数据库架构。 数据库通常包含许多表。经过良好优化的架构可以提高性能。这包括使用适当的数据类型、设置主键和外键以及避免冗余数据。
有效使用索引。 索引可以减少搜索数据所花费的时间来提高 数据库的性能。企业应该有效使用索引,包括在常用列上创建索引、避免索引过多以及定期检查和优化索引。
Post Reply